Latest Patents

Michel Niquet holds a patent for a "Device for compacting a tubular structure, associated installation and method." This compacter features a compacting roller assembly supported by a robust support element. The roller assembly consists of a straight central shaft with a longitudinal axis, along with multiple compacting rollers arranged parallel to one another around the central shaft. Each roller is designed with a peripheral surface that rotates around the central shaft, and the roller axes are inclined at a specific angle relative to the longitudinal axis of the central shaft. This innovative design allows for effective compaction of tubular structures.
